Robert Sinclair (1817-1898) was Chief Mechanical Engineer of the Caledonian Railway from 1847-1856 and of the Great Eastern Railway from 1862-1866. The Caledonian Railway was a major Scottish railway company operating in Scotland. It was formed in the early 19th century and it was absorbed almost a century later into the London, Midland and Scottish Railway, in the 1923 railway grouping, by means of the Railways Act 1921. Due to legal complications this did not take place on 1 January 1923 when the majority of the amalgamations took place, but was delayed until 1 July 1923 (along with the North Staffordshire Railway).
